""The Revelation of Our Lord and Savior Jesus Christ V2: Historically and Critically Interpreted"" is a book written by Philip Gell and published in 1854. This book is a detailed analysis of the biblical book of Revelation, which is considered one of the most complex and mysterious books of the New Testament. The author provides a historical and critical interpretation of the text, examining the cultural and religious context in which it was written, as well as the literary and theological aspects of the book.The book is divided into chapters, each of which focuses on a specific theme or aspect of the book of Revelation. Gell discusses the symbolism used in the book, the identity of the author, the historical events that may have influenced the writing of the book, and the various interpretations that have been proposed throughout history. He also provides his own interpretation of the book, based on his extensive research and analysis.Overall, ""The Revelation of Our Lord and Savior Jesus Christ V2: Historically and Critically Interpreted"" is a comprehensive and insightful study of the book of Revelation.
